软件开发报价清单
软件开发是一项非常重要的工作,涉及到企业或个人的日常运营和商业活动。随着数字化时代的到来,软件开发变得越来越普遍,因此软件开发报价清单也变得越来越重要。下面是一份软件开发报价清单,可以帮助您更好地了解软件开发的成本和复杂性。
1. 需求分析
需求分析是软件开发的第一步。在这个过程中,开发人员需要与客户或用户进行沟通,了解他们的需求和期望。这可能需要一些时间,但是非常重要的一步,因为它可以确保开发团队知道要开发什么,以及如何开发。
2. 设计
设计阶段是软件开发的关键阶段。在这个阶段,开发人员需要创建软件的架构和设计模式,以确保软件可以正常运行。这可能需要一些时间,但可以帮助开发人员更好地理解客户的需求和期望,并确保软件具有可维护性和可扩展性。
3. 开发
开发阶段是软件开发的核心。在这个阶段,开发人员使用编程语言和工具来创建软件。这可能包括编写代码、调试、测试和优化软件。这个过程可能需要几个月或更长时间,具体取决于开发人员的技能和经验。
4. 测试
测试是软件开发的重要环节。开发人员需要测试软件以确保其正常运行,并修复任何错误或缺陷。这可能需要一些时间,但可以帮助开发人员确保软件的质量和可靠性。
5. 部署
部署阶段是将软件部署到客户或用户计算机上的最后一步。这可能需要一些时间,但可以帮助开发人员确保软件可以正常运行,并让客户或用户可以使用。
6. 维护
维护阶段是软件开发的重要组成部分。开发人员需要更新和维护软件,以确保其正常运行并满足客户或用户的需求。这可能需要一些时间,但可以帮助开发人员确保软件的稳定性和可靠性。
以上是软件开发报价清单的几个方面,可以帮助您更好地了解软件开发的成本和复杂性。不过,软件开发是一个复杂的过程,价格可能会因地区、团队和技术等因素而异。因此,在选择开发人员和项目时,请确保与他们进行充分的沟通和谈判,以获得最好的价格和服务质量。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。